The psychiatrist Dr Elisabeth Kübler-Ross staged emotional responses to death and dying into five (5) stages (DABDA, D: denial, A: anger, B: bargaining, D: depression, A: acceptance.
According to Kübler-Ross the first stage being denial serves as a form of defense mechanism, such as denying the inevitable by professing otherwise. Denial can also be a positive coping mechanism in some people.
